Loading services/camera/libcameraservice/api1/Camera2Client.cpp +25 −23 Original line number Original line Diff line number Diff line Loading @@ -780,6 +780,7 @@ status_t Camera2Client::startPreviewL(Parameters ¶ms, bool restart) { int lastJpegStreamId = mJpegProcessor->getStreamId(); int lastJpegStreamId = mJpegProcessor->getStreamId(); // If jpeg stream will slow down preview, make sure we remove it before starting preview // If jpeg stream will slow down preview, make sure we remove it before starting preview if (params.slowJpegMode) { if (params.slowJpegMode) { if (lastJpegStreamId != NO_STREAM) { // Pause preview if we are streaming // Pause preview if we are streaming int32_t activeRequestId = mStreamingProcessor->getActiveRequestId(); int32_t activeRequestId = mStreamingProcessor->getActiveRequestId(); if (activeRequestId != 0) { if (activeRequestId != 0) { Loading Loading @@ -809,6 +810,7 @@ status_t Camera2Client::startPreviewL(Parameters ¶ms, bool restart) { __FUNCTION__, mCameraId, strerror(-res), res); __FUNCTION__, mCameraId, strerror(-res), res); } } } } } } else { } else { res = updateProcessorStream(mJpegProcessor, params); res = updateProcessorStream(mJpegProcessor, params); if (res != OK) { if (res != OK) { Loading Loading
services/camera/libcameraservice/api1/Camera2Client.cpp +25 −23 Original line number Original line Diff line number Diff line Loading @@ -780,6 +780,7 @@ status_t Camera2Client::startPreviewL(Parameters ¶ms, bool restart) { int lastJpegStreamId = mJpegProcessor->getStreamId(); int lastJpegStreamId = mJpegProcessor->getStreamId(); // If jpeg stream will slow down preview, make sure we remove it before starting preview // If jpeg stream will slow down preview, make sure we remove it before starting preview if (params.slowJpegMode) { if (params.slowJpegMode) { if (lastJpegStreamId != NO_STREAM) { // Pause preview if we are streaming // Pause preview if we are streaming int32_t activeRequestId = mStreamingProcessor->getActiveRequestId(); int32_t activeRequestId = mStreamingProcessor->getActiveRequestId(); if (activeRequestId != 0) { if (activeRequestId != 0) { Loading Loading @@ -809,6 +810,7 @@ status_t Camera2Client::startPreviewL(Parameters ¶ms, bool restart) { __FUNCTION__, mCameraId, strerror(-res), res); __FUNCTION__, mCameraId, strerror(-res), res); } } } } } } else { } else { res = updateProcessorStream(mJpegProcessor, params); res = updateProcessorStream(mJpegProcessor, params); if (res != OK) { if (res != OK) { Loading